Harold L. Fridkin

Experience
  • Mr. Fridkin is a recognized expert in local government and inter-governmental issues.
  • He has served both Jackson County as County Counselor for two appointed terms, and Kansas City, Missouri as counsel to the Tax Increment Financing Commission, the Economic Development Corporation, the Kansas City Port Authority and was Chairman of the Land Clearance for Redevelopment Authority.
  • During his tenure as County Counselor, he provided leadership in the structuring and financing of the Truman Sports Complex and Truman Medical Center.
  • He served as Chairman of the Jackson County Charter Commission, which in 1970 brought home-rule to the county.
  • Mr. Fridkin has considerable experience in the area of governmental authority and taxing issues. He also has considerable experience in trying jury cases, mostly as defense counsel and has also conducted appellate practice in Missouri courts.
  • He has been counsel to the Missouri Transportation and Development Counsel, the Builders' Association of Kansas City, the Minority Contractors' Association and others.
  • Mr. Fridkin has made numerous filings for developers under the Interstate Land Sales Full Disclosure Act. For many years he served as counsel for Prime Health, the first federally qualified HMO in the Midwest.

Honors
  • Selected among The Best Lawyers in America®, 2007 and 2008
  • Mr. Fridkin was named among the 175 most influential people in the history of Jackson County by the Jackson County Historical Society in 2001.
  • Certificate of Merit, League of Women Voters, 1982, for serving as lead attorney in Congressional Redistricting Case.
  • Annual Achievement Award, K.C. Bar Association, 1970
